George MacLean was born c.1898 in Kilininian, Argyll & Bute, Scotland. He matriculated into the medical faculty at the University of Glasgow in 1910. In his first year he studied Chemistry, Anatomy, Zoology, and Practical Zoology. His second year subjects were Anatomy and Physiology.
